A Structured Foundation for Legal Intelligence
In Darven, knowledge bases (KBs) are organized collections of legal content. They provide the assistant with structured, contextual data for answering questions, analyzing documents, and supporting legal workflows.Each KB consists of documents and segmented chunks that are searchable, traceable, and tailored to a legal system or context.
Types of Knowledge Bases
Public, Private, and Jurisdiction-Aware
Public Knowledge Bases
Federal and regional legal texts maintained by Darven, available by jurisdiction (e.g., UAE, France, etc.).
Private Knowledge Bases
Internal legal documents and memos uploaded by users, tailored to their specific legal context.
Jurisdiction-Aware Knowledge Bases
Auto-linked to users based on country, ensuring every query is answered with appropriate legal context.
